About The Position

TRP has a current vacancy for an Architectural Technical Lead. The Architectural Technical Lead provides technical leadership for architectural design and coordination across a major rail transit infrastructure project delivered by Trillium Rail Partners (TRP). This role ensures architectural designs meet operational, safety, accessibility, and passenger experience requirements while supporting constructability and integration with all engineering disciplines. The role works closely with structural, mechanical, electrical, and systems teams to deliver functional and well-coordinated transit facilities.

Responsibilities

  • Provide technical leadership for architectural scope across stations, entrances, ancillary buildings, and public spaces.
  • Ensure consistency in the architecture designs and solutions across the project.
  • Mentor architectural technical coordinators across the project.
  • Review architectural design packages, drawings, specifications, material and finishes selection, and technical submissions.
  • Ensure architectural designs meet accessibility, safety, durability, and passenger flow requirements.
  • Coordinate architectural elements with structural, mechanical, electrical, and systems infrastructure.
  • Support constructability reviews and value engineering exercises.
  • Participate in design reviews, stakeholder workshops, and technical coordination meetings.
  • Support resolution of architectural technical issues, RFIs, and design changes during construction.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able building codes, accessibility standards, and transit authority design guidelines.
  • Assist the construction, procurement, estimating and scheduling teams with technical review and inputs of construction schedule, procurement packages, estimating scope and assumption and scheduling assumptions.
  • Support integration of architectural components with testing, commissioning, and final project delivery.
